I am now pretty sure that the problem is corruption on the gnome virtual filesystem metadata that causes this, and that is caused by user error. Clearing the cache when the drive isn't in use fixes the problem. It is relatively easy to corrupt the data. One has to delete a dir before the file operation has returned from a move of the files into another place. I think this situation is caused because the device is very slow on some requests. I would say my disk is not supported, but still there may be a way to protect the metadata in software, such as a system of one or more locks that prevent corruption. When the drive begins to get sluggish I run the following script. rm -rf ~/.local/share/gvfs-metadata pkill gvfsd-metadata Since I have no documentation of what is written into that metadata binary data file, I am assuming it is a structure in C or an object instance in C++, I cannot troubleshoot what I believe to be corruption that hangs nautalus. If i resort to shell commands on the drive, I do not experience the delays. Since I want the features of the FM, I clear the cache with the above commands. If you want troubleshooting of the metadata I need a utility that can run diagnostics on it. If such a tool exists, I haven't found it.
